House raising services involve elevating a property to a higher level, typically to protect it from flooding, water damage, or to facilitate repairs to the foundation. The process generally includes lifting the entire structure off its existing foundation, performing necessary repairs or modifications, and then setting it back onto a new or adjusted foundation. This service requires specialized equipment and expertise to ensure the stability and integrity of the building throughout the process. One of the primary issues that house raising addresses is flood risk mitigation. Properties located in flood-prone areas or near bodies of water may be elevated to prevent water intrusion during heavy rains or rising water levels. Additionally, house raising can help resolve problems related to aging or damaged foundations, such as uneven settling or structural instability. By elevating a home, property owners can also create additional usable space underneath the house for parking, storage, or other purposes, making it a practical solution for increasing property value and functionality.
This service is commonly used for residential properties, especially older homes or those situated in flood zones. It can also be applicable to commercial buildings that require elevation to meet local regulations or improve resilience against water-related issues. The types of properties that typically undergo house raising include single-family homes, historic structures, and small commercial buildings. The decision to elevate a property often depends on factors like location, structural condition, and the specific needs of the property owner.

Typical Costs - House raising services generally range from $30,000 to $100,000 depending on the home's size, foundation type, and local labor rates. For example, a modest single-story home might cost around $35,000, while larger or more complex projects can approach $90,000 or more.
Factors Influencing Price - Costs vary based on the home's height, foundation condition, and whether additional work like utility disconnects or foundation repair is needed. A standard house raising in Menomonee Falls might fall within the $40,000 to $70,000 range, but unique circumstances can increase this estimate.
Estimate Variability - The total expense can fluctuate significantly depending on the home's design and site access. Some projects may be on the lower end around $25,000, while intricate or large-scale raises could exceed $120,000 in certain cases.
Cost Considerations - Pros typically provide detailed estimates after assessing the home's structure and site conditions. It is advisable to obtain multiple quotes to compare costs and services for house raising projects in the local area.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
